Program overview:
The STAR program is a specialized therapeutic classroom designed for students with
average academic aptitude who face challenges in a traditional general education
environment due to social, emotional, or behavioral needs. The program offers a highly
structured and supportive setting with a low student-to-teacher ratio. Instruction is
individualized and delivered in small groups to maximize student engagement and success.
